Aggresive Villagers by NotreallyCareless in aoe2

[–]afhamash 2 points3 points  (0 children)

This would make any melee unit rush unviable, if not delayed. You'd have to wait for like 4-5 scouts at least before rushing out. That's not a rush then. People are full walled way before that.

This would also make the meta heavily skewed towards Archer plays in feudal. Only in castle age would melee units start becoming viable.

With no feudal aggression, Arabia won't be Arabia anymore.
